Key Headlines Impacting BXP

Here are the key news stories impacting BXP this week:

  • Positive Sentiment: Premium-office leasing is reportedly surging, improving BXP’s ability to raise occupancy, rents and cash flow at higher-quality properties. This supports the company’s strategy of focusing on well-located office assets and could help offset weakness in older buildings. BXP Gains Leverage as Premium Office Leasing Surges
  • Positive Sentiment: BXP secured a $1.2 billion construction loan for its 343 Madison Avenue office tower in Midtown Manhattan. The financing advances a major development and demonstrates lender support for the project, which is positioned to benefit from demand for premium New York office space. BXP Secures $1.2B Construction Loan for 343 Madison Avenue Office Tower
  • Positive Sentiment: The company is finalizing equity and construction arrangements for its Worldgate project and considering another Washington, D.C., office redevelopment. Law firms’ demand for high-end space could create attractive redevelopment opportunities and support long-term growth. BXP finalizes equity, construction deals for Worldgate project
  • Neutral Sentiment: An affiliate of Douglas Development is under contract to acquire a Dupont Circle office building from BXP. The sale could provide liquidity and streamline the portfolio, although disposing of an asset also reduces the company’s property base and future rental income. Douglas Development affiliate under contract to buy Dupont Circle office building from BXP
  • Negative Sentiment: The $1.2 billion loan increases BXP’s debt obligations and exposes the company to interest-rate, construction-cost and leasing risks. With leverage already elevated, investors may be cautious until the tower is completed and successfully leased. BXP Secures $1.2B Loan for Midtown Manhattan Office Tower

BXP (NYSE:BXPG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, July 28th. The real estate investment trust reported $0.43 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.40 by $0.03. BXP had a return on equity of 3.88% and a net margin of 8.44%.The company had revenue of $895.70 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$858.07 million.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$1.71 earnings per share. BXP’s revenue was up 3.1% compared to the same quarter last year. BXP has set its FY 2026 guidance at 6.990-7.050 EPS and its Q3 2026 guidance at 1.800-1.820 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ts expect that BXP will post 7 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About BXP

Boston Properties, Inc (NYSE: BXP) is a publicly traded real estate investment trust (REIT) specializing in the ownership, management, and development of Class A office properties across major U.S. markets. Head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, the company’s portfolio comprises high-quality office buildings, mixed-use developments and select retail assets designed to serve leading corporations in key metropolitan areas.

Established in 1970 by Mortimer B. Zuckerman, Boston Properties has grown through disciplined acquisitions and strategic ground-up developments.
